How Far Can a Peristaltic Pump Draw Water Vertically?

0
11

When it comes to transferring water or other fluids, peristaltic pumps are often praised for their clean, leak-free operation and gentle fluid handling. But one common question arises among users and engineers alike: How deep can a peristaltic pump pull water?

In this article, we’ll explain the suction capabilities of peristaltic pumps, what affects their performance, and how to use them effectively in fluid transfer systems.

Understanding the Suction Lift of a Peristaltic Pump

Unlike submersible or centrifugal pumps, peristaltic pumps are self-priming and can draw fluid from below the pump inlet—even when dry. However, there are physical limits to how far vertically they can "pull" water.

✅ Typical Suction Lift Range:

Most standard peristaltic pumps can achieve a dry lift of 5 to 8 meters (16 to 26 feet), depending on:

  • Pump size and design

  • Tube elasticity and diameter

  • Fluid viscosity and temperature

  • Atmospheric pressure

This makes them suitable for shallow well or tank suction applications, especially when chemical compatibility or contamination control is a concern.

How Do Peristaltic Pumps Pull Water?

A peristaltic pump works by compressing a flexible tube with rotating rollers, creating a vacuum that draws fluid into the tube as it moves. This process creates intermittent negative pressure, allowing the pump to lift liquid from a lower level—without any mechanical parts touching the fluid.

Because of this seal-less, non-contact design, peristaltic pumps can handle:

  • Dirty or abrasive water

  • Viscous or shear-sensitive fluids

  • Corrosive chemicals

However, due to the nature of atmospheric pressure and the tubing’s mechanical limits, suction depth has an upper limit.

Factors That Limit Suction Depth

While 5–8 meters is common, actual performance depends on:

  • Altitude: Higher elevations reduce atmospheric pressure, lowering suction capability.

  • Tubing material: Stiffer or thicker tubes may limit vacuum efficiency.

  • Fluid density: Heavier or viscous fluids resist suction more than water.

  • Temperature: Warmer fluids may reduce viscosity, but extremely hot fluids can deform tubing.

  • Pump speed: Higher speeds improve flow rate but may affect priming.

To maximize performance, always mount the pump as close to the fluid source as possible.

Applications That Benefit from Suction Lift

Even with depth limitations, peristaltic pumps excel in many suction-based systems, such as:

  • Chemical dosing from storage tanks

  • Water sampling from shallow wells or ponds

  • Drum emptying in pharmaceutical or food processing

  • Remote water transfer in agriculture or environmental monitoring

Their ability to run dry, self-prime, and handle aggressive or sensitive fluids makes them highly versatile—even when deeper lift isn’t required.

Conclusion: Know the Limits, Use Them Right

While peristaltic pumps are not designed for deep well pumping, they offer reliable suction for moderate vertical lifts up to 8 meters, making them a powerful tool for clean and controlled fluid transfer.
